The two organizations, working alongside their Public Engagement, Trust and Confidence Committee, intend to use the upcoming semiquincentennial as a catalyst for renewed civic education. By launching local courthouse events and educational partnerships, the judiciary aims to demystify its function within the constitutional democracy and bridge the gap between legal institutions and the public.
"State courts play a vital role in protecting constitutional rights, resolving disputes fairly and impartially and preserving public confidence in the rule of law," the groups noted in their official declaration. To support this initiative, the National Center for State Courts will provide resources and identify best practices for courts looking to deepen community engagement throughout the commemorative year.
